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7902850968 3951219 763000 8284103168
6581543 20153343
6581543 20153343
261 60326075007 01 27801063
All about undefined
Interested in learning more?
6581543 20153343
261 60326075007 01 27801063
See more
156857 82432
9155 1629 6738464 025416 2857
See more
15 5273942 129
950 6133624684 277814
See more